而服务器CPU作为其核心部件,其性能的高低更是决定性因素之一
那么,如何科学、准确地划分服务器CPU的高低档次呢?本文将从多个维度深入探讨,旨在为读者提供一个清晰、有说服力的解答
一、核心数与线程数:基础而关键的指标 首先,服务器CPU的核心数与线程数是衡量其性能高低的基础指标
核心数指的是CPU内部物理处理器的数量,直接决定了并行处理任务的能力;而线程数则是通过超线程技术(如Intel的Hyper-Threading)或类似机制,在单个核心上模拟出多个线程来同时处理任务,从而进一步提升CPU的利用率和性能
一般来说,核心数与线程数越多,CPU的并行处理能力越强,适合处理大规模并发请求或复杂计算任务,因此被视为高性能CPU的重要标志
二、主频与缓存:速度与效率的双重保障 除了核心数与线程数,CPU的主频和缓存也是决定其性能高低的关键因素
主频即CPU的工作频率,以GHz为单位,它直接影响到CPU执行指令的速度
主频越高,CPU在单位时间内能完成的指令周期越多,处理速度自然越快
然而,单纯追求高主频并非总是最优选择,因为高主频往往伴随着更高的功耗和发热量
另一方面,缓存作为CPU与内存之间的桥梁,其大小和类型对性能也有显著影响
缓存分为L1、L2、L3等多个层级,越靠近CPU核心的缓存访问速度越快,能够极大减少CPU访问内存的次数,提升数据处理效率
因此,拥有大容量、高效能缓存的CPU往往能提供更出色的性能表现
三、指令集与架构设计:技术的深度体现 指令集是CPU所能识别和执行的所有指令的集合,它决定了CPU的功能和特性
现代CPU普遍支持多种指令集,包括但不限于x86、x64、ARM等
高级指令集能够提供更丰富的功能和更高效的执行方式,如SIMD(单指令多数据)指令集能够同时处理多个数据,极大提升数据处理能力
此外,CPU的架构设计也是决定其性能高低的重要因素
不同的架构设计在功耗管理、缓存利用、并行处理等方面有着不同的优化策略
例如,Intel的酷睿(Core)系列和AMD的锐龙(Ryze